RestTemplate 自定义 ErrorHandler

在使用 Spring Boot 的 RestTemplate 调用时,发现调用成功时很好用,但是服务器返回 4xx 或者 5xx 异常时,这货直接给抛出来了,想要处理可以自定义 ErrorHandler。

问题

当服务端返回非 200 时,调用方直接抛出如下异常:

终于看到了想要的,可以看出 hasError 为 true,即有错误时,会走 errorHandler.handleError(url, method, response),接下来继续查看这个 errorHandler 的源码:

可算找到原因了,原来在这里抛出了一个 HttpClientErrorException,既然 DefaultResponseErrorHandler 实现了 ResponseErrorHandler,而且从名字上看貌似是个默认的错误处理,那我们可以尝试自定义 ErrorHandler 实现 ResponseErrorHandler 来处理异常情况。

自定义 ErrorHandler

import org.springframework.http.client.ClientHttpResponse;
import org.springframework.web.client.DefaultResponseErrorHandler;

import java.io.IOException;

/**
* @author tryme.wang
* @create 2018-12-03 11:10
* @description 远程调用自定义异常Handler
**/
public class RestErrorHandler extends DefaultResponseErrorHandler {

@Override
public boolean hasError(ClientHttpResponse response) throws IOException {
// 是否有错 返回false即手动设置了不管response是什么都没有错
return false;
}

@Override
public void handleError(ClientHttpResponse response) throws IOException {
// 暂时空着
}
}

别忘记配置进去:

import com.merrichat.im.common.handler.RestErrorHandler;
import org.springframework.context.annotation.Bean;
import org.springframework.context.annotation.Configuration;
import org.springframework.http.client.ClientHttpRequestFactory;
import org.springframework.http.client.SimpleClientHttpRequestFactory;
import org.springframework.web.client.RestTemplate;

/**
* @author tryme.wang
* @create 2018-11-30 10:59:48
* @desc http请求配置 (替代httpclient)
**/
@Configuration
public class RestTemplateConfig {
@Bean
public RestTemplate restTemplate(ClientHttpRequestFactory factory) {
RestTemplate restTemplate = new RestTemplate(factory);
// 使用自定义的ErrorHandler
restTemplate.setErrorHandler(new RestErrorHandler());
return restTemplate;
}

@Bean
public ClientHttpRequestFactory simpleClientHttpRequestFactory() {
SimpleClientHttpRequestFactory factory = new SimpleClientHttpRequestFactory();
// 单位:ms
factory.setReadTimeout(5000);
// 单位:ms
factory.setConnectTimeout(15000);
return factory;
}
}

这样无论服务端返回什么状态码,客户端都会认为没错,我们就可以获取想要的 statusCode 或者 body 进而来处理各种业务了😉。
